DAME EDNA'S GLORIOUS GOODBYE Tour Coming to National Theatre, 4/21-26
By: Tyler Peterson
In a side-splitting, historic finale, Dame Edna Everage (Barry Humphries) is capping a spectacular career spanning 50 years of bravura showmanship in this farewell celebratory show at the National Theatre for one week only, April 21- 26. Dame Edna's Glorious Goodbye - The Farewell Tour will give audiences the chance to bid farewell to the incomparable Dame Edna, arguably Australia's greatest entertainment export.

Surrounded by spectacular sets and gorgeous, talented dancers, Dame Edna keeps her audience enthralled and "in stitches" with her sparkling wit, mischievous wisdom and razor-sharp banter. With her take-no-prisoners comedy and hijinks, Dame Edna is not going out with a whimper: No one is safe from the Dame's wicked tongue. This brand new show is directed by award-winning Simon Phillips, who directed the original Priscilla Queen of the Desert and is currently directing First Wives Club, with design by Tony Award-winning Brian Thomson, who designed the original Australian and London productions of Jesus Christ Superstar and The Rocky Horror Show, as well as the closing ceremony of the Sydney Olympic Games.Photo by Craig Schwartz
